I can't wait either, got my tickets booked for opening night!

Adams always said that each incarnation of the Hitchhikers guide was to be a progression and not just a remake of the previous versions. Most of the new stuff in the movie is actually straight from Adams and his years of trying to get the movie made before his death, I'm really optimistic to be honest and I definitly think that most of the casting is spot-on.

Martin Freeman seems perfect as Arthur Dent, although I do remember reading at some point in the past Adams wanted Hugh Laurie as Dent in the movie. Both seem pretty well suited to the role IMO.

Marvin looks great too, and who else to voice a paranoid android but Alan Rickman!
